External pushing device for rigid frame bridge body
The invention relates to the technical field of bridge engineering, and particularly discloses a rigid frame bridge external pushing device which comprises a double-I-shaped steel rail, the double-I-shaped steel rail is connected with a machine body in a sliding mode, extension rods are fixedly installed at the four corners of the machine body, the extension rods are fixedly connected with fixing shafts, and the fixing shafts are fixedly connected with the double-I-shaped steel rail. The fixing shaft is rotationally connected with a first rotating arm rod, one end of the first rotating arm rod is rotationally connected with an abutting block, a brake pad is arranged at one end of the abutting block, lifting pressing rods are slidably connected to the four corners of the machine body correspondingly, and first connecting arm rods are rotationally connected to the two sides of one end of each lifting pressing rod correspondingly. When the device is used for pushing and supporting a bridge, a machine body can be effectively limited and fixed to a track, so that the machine body is prevented from position deviation due to the influence of external force, and the service life of the machine body is prolonged.
